Bethany College Accounting Bachelor’s Program Diversity

Among recent graduates, 33% of accounting bachelor’s degrees went to men and 67% went to women.

Bethany College gender breakdown of Accounting Bachelor's degree grads

The largest share of accounting bachelor’s degree graduates at Bethany College are White. Roughly 67%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Bethany College with a bachelor’s in accounting.
